  • Two-Way Sync
    Keep your systems perfectly aligned with Stacksync’s reliable two-way data synchronization. Changes made in one platform automatically update across all connected systems in real time, eliminating data silos, reducing errors, and ensuring your teams always work with the latest information.
  • Workflow Automation
    Stop building brittle API scripts. With Stacksync, you can trigger complex automated workflows using simple SQL commands. Instantly initiate email sequences, update CRM statuses, or fire webhooks whenever a specific record changes in your database, giving you total control without the maintenance headache.
  • EDI
    Transform legacy EDI complexity into simple database interactions. Stacksync automatically parses incoming EDI documents directly into your database tables and converts outgoing data back into compliant EDI formats. Manage your supply chain with the ease of SQL, not ancient file parsers.
  • Databases
    Interact with your CRM, ERP, and payment tools as if they were just another table in your database. Stacksync mirrors your SaaS data into Postgres or Snowflake in real-time, allowing you to read and write data using standard SQL. Say goodbye to rate limits and complex API documentation.

Why should a person choose your product over its competitors?

Stacksync's answer:

Stacksync is built for teams that need reliable, real-time data sync at scale. Unlike automation or batch ETL tools, it provides sub-second, bidirectional synchronization without API limits, complex scripts, or per-row pricing surprises.

How would you describe the primary audience of your product?

Stacksync's answer:

Engineering, data, and operations teams at mid-market and enterprise companies that need to keep CRMs, ERPs, and databases perfectly in sync in real time.

What's the story behind your product?

Stacksync's answer:

Stacksync was created to solve a common problem faced by data and engineering teams: keeping business systems in sync without relying on fragile scripts, slow batch jobs, or API limitations. The goal was to build a reliable, real-time sync layer that works directly at the data level and scales with modern companies.
